CESAFI enters new digital era

CEBU, Philippines — Three debuting schools, one new sporting event, and a ground-breaking digital platform are in store for the highly anticipated Cebu Schools Athletic Foundation, Inc. (CESAFI) 2026 season, which will kick off with its centerpiece basketball tournament on Saturday, August 29, at the Cebu Coliseum.
CESAFI Commissioner Felix “Boy” Tiukinhoy, Jr. announced that the league is entering a new digital era through the CESAFI.ph, an online home designed to bring the league’s games, athletes, schools, stories, and statistics closer to its growing community.
“For years, the CESAFI has been a defining part of Cebu’s student-sports landscape, with competition and school pride shaping its legacy. Now the league is expanding that experience beyond the physical venue,” said Tiukinhoy during the formal launching of CESAFI Sesson 26 on Wednesday, August 26, at Marco Polo Hotel.
“CESAFI.ph provides a digital ecosystem where fans can now watch livestreams and weekly game recaps, follow the competition, view schedules and access game information, and stay connected with the athletes and teams that make up the league. Accessible through the website and a downloadable app, it covers the breadth of CESAFI’s sports and gives greater visibility to the matchups.”
Tiukinhoy said the platform also opens new ways for the league to tell the stories behind the games, including player profiles and live statistics.
“With the young athletes at the center of the experience, CESAFI gives them a digital space for their accomplishments to be recorded throughout their CESAFI careers and shared with schools and the wider community,” Tiukinhoy added.
“At the heart of this shift is a simple idea that each game is worth witnessing both within and beyond the venue, remaining accessible to subscribers even after the season. As home to Cebu’s student sports, CESAFI aims to give the next generation of athletes and their stories a space to be remembered.”
Meanwhile, a total of 13 schools, including newcomers San Roque College de Cebu (SRCDC) Greyhounds and PAREF Springdale Titans, will be competing in the juniors category and nine in the college division, including the debuting Univesity of Cebu Lapu-Lapu and Mandaue (UCLM).
Pickleball (college level) will be contested for the first time in Cebu’s premier inter-school athletic league.
The other events in CESAFI sports calendar this year include athletics, badminton, beach volley, chess, dancesport, football, karatedo, scrabble, swimming, table tennis, taekwondo, tennis, volleyball, and e-sports.
